Per-developer AI spending can appear disproportionate within engineering teams, but understanding its value requires evaluating the output it generates rather than merely the cost. High AI expenditures by certain developers often reflect their use of agentic coding tools, which can lead to significant productivity gains. Instead of focusing solely on the dollar amount, teams should assess metrics like cost per pull request (PR) to gauge efficiency and productivity. By integrating AI spend data with engineering outputs such as PRs merged or tickets closed, companies can better understand the true value of their AI investments. This approach shifts the conversation from reducing expenses to maximizing the return on investment, similar to strategies used in managing cloud costs. Understanding and optimizing these dynamics helps teams ensure that their AI-related expenditures contribute to increased productivity and efficient resource use.
